The Art of Timing: Mastering the Chicken's Journey
The fundamental mechanic of the game revolves around precise timing. Players must tap or click at the opportune moment to move the chicken forward, navigating a stream of vehicles and other obstacles. This requires more than just quick reactions; it demands an understanding of the traffic patterns and the ability to predict the gaps between cars. Successfully crossing requires a delicate balance of courage and caution. Hesitation can be just as detrimental as recklessness, making each decision critical to the chicken’s survival. The developers often incorporate variations in vehicle speed and density, creating a dynamic and unpredictable environment that keeps players on their toes. Learning to anticipate these changes is key to achieving consistently high scores.

Beyond Cars: Adapting to Diverse Challenges
While automobiles represent the most common hazard, many versions of the chicken crossing game introduce a variety of other challenges to keep players engaged. These can include rivers, trains, or even moving platforms, each requiring a different approach to navigation. Rivers, for example, might necessitate timed jumps or the utilization of floating objects. Trains demand even more precise timing due to their greater speed and size. The introduction of these varied obstacles keeps the gameplay fresh and prevents it from becoming repetitive. It also encourages players to develop a more versatile skillset, adapting their strategies to overcome a wider range of hurdles. The unexpected nature of these obstacles adds an element of surprise and excitement to the game.

The Psychological Appeal: Why We Enjoy Tiny Digital Risks
The enduring popularity of simple games like the chicken crossing genre lies in their ability to tap into fundamental psychological principles. The feeling of overcoming a challenge, even a small one, releases dopamine in the brain, creating a sense of pleasure and accomplishment. The element of risk adds an additional layer of excitement, as players are constantly aware of the potential for failure. This creates a thrilling experience that keeps them engaged. The simplicity of the game also makes it accessible to a wide audience, while the quick gameplay loop provides instant gratification. The inherent absurdity of the premise – guiding a chicken across a road – adds a touch of humor and lightheartedness.
